You've done it before and you can do it now. See the positive possibilities. Redirect the substantial energy of your frustration and turn it into positive, effective, unstoppable determination.
Interpretation
The quote encourages harnessing past experiences to overcome current challenges and transform frustration into determination.
Ralph Marston's quote emphasizes the importance of recognizing one's past successes to inspire confidence in tackling present tasks. It suggests that by focusing on positive possibilities and redirecting negative emotions like frustration, individuals can cultivate a strong, unstoppable determination to achieve their goals.
